An Advanced Certificate in IT Compliance Documentation equips professionals with the skills to manage and create comprehensive documentation for IT systems, ensuring adherence to industry regulations and best practices. This program emphasizes practical application, preparing graduates for immediate impact within their organizations.
Learning outcomes include mastering documentation techniques for audits (internal and external), developing policies and procedures aligned with standards like ISO 27001 and NIST Cybersecurity Framework, and effectively communicating compliance information across technical and non-technical audiences. Proficiency in risk assessment documentation and remediation strategies is also a key focus.
The duration of the program typically ranges from several weeks to a few months, depending on the intensity and learning modality (online or in-person). The flexible format caters to working professionals seeking upskilling or career advancement in IT governance, risk, and compliance (GRC).
This certification holds significant industry relevance, making graduates highly sought after in various sectors. Organizations across finance, healthcare, and technology prioritize individuals adept at managing IT compliance documentation, making it a valuable asset in securing and maintaining sensitive data and operations. Skills learned are directly applicable to roles such as Compliance Officer, IT Auditor, and Security Analyst.
